2026实战OpenClaw(龙虾)如何安装
2026-03-19 0引言
2026实战OpenClaw(龙虾)如何安装 是指面向中国跨境卖家,在2026年实操环境中部署与配置 OpenClaw 工具(业内俗称“龙虾”)的技术操作指南。OpenClaw 是一款开源的、面向跨境电商合规风控场景的数据抓取与监控工具,常用于监测平台下架风险、TRO诉讼关联商品、类目政策变动等;安装 指在本地服务器或云环境完成依赖配置、代码拉取、环境变量设置及基础服务启动的过程。

要点速读(TL;DR)
- OpenClaw 非官方SaaS产品,无“一键安装包”,需开发者手动部署;
- 2026年主流适配环境为 Ubuntu 22.04+ / Python 3.11+ / Docker 24+;
- 核心依赖含 Playwright(浏览器自动化)、PostgreSQL(存储)、Redis(队列),缺一不可;
- 安装失败主因是 Chromium 下载超时、权限配置错误、端口冲突;
- 不建议新手跳过
.env配置直接运行,否则无法连接数据库或触发监控任务。
它能解决哪些问题
- 场景痛点: 突然收到平台下架通知,但缺乏历史数据比对 → 价值: 通过 OpenClaw 定期快照商品页、评论区、类目路径,构建可回溯的变更时间线;
- 场景痛点: 同一品牌多站点被TRO起诉,人工排查耗时长 → 价值: 利用内置 TRO 关键词库+ASIN反查逻辑,自动标记高风险链接并生成证据截图;
- 场景痛点: 运营依赖第三方监控工具,数据颗粒度粗、API频次受限 → 价值: 自建 OpenClaw 实例可定制采集字段(如Buy Box状态、促销标签、库存标识),响应延迟低于3分钟。
怎么用/怎么开通/怎么选择
OpenClaw 为开源项目(GitHub仓库:openclaw/openclaw),无官方销售/开通流程,安装即启用。常见部署路径如下(以 Ubuntu 22.04 为例):
- 准备环境: 安装 Python 3.11、Docker、docker-compose v2.20+;
- 克隆代码: 执行
git clone https://github.com/openclaw/openclaw.git && cd openclaw; - 配置依赖: 运行
make setup(自动安装 Playwright 及 Chromium,需确保境外网络可达); - 编辑配置: 复制
.env.example为.env,填写POSTGRES_URL、REDIS_URL、PLAYWRIGHT_HEADLESS=false(调试时设为 true); - 启动服务: 执行
docker-compose up -d,检查docker ps中 web、worker、db、redis 容器状态; - 验证接入: 访问
http://localhost:8000/api/health返回{"status":"ok"},且日志中无ConnectionRefused报错。
⚠️ 注意:2026年部分云厂商(如阿里云国际站、AWS ap-northeast-1)已屏蔽 Chromium 默认下载源,需在 playwright install-deps 前配置国内镜像源或使用预编译二进制包 —— 具体以 Playwright 官方CLI文档 为准。
费用/成本通常受哪些因素影响
- 服务器资源规格(CPU/内存/磁盘IO):影响并发采集能力与存储容量;
- 目标站点反爬强度:高难度站点(如Amazon JP、Shopee MY)需更多代理IP与重试策略,推高带宽与代理成本;
- 自建数据库运维投入:若不用托管 PostgreSQL(如AWS RDS、腾讯云 CDB),需自行维护备份、扩缩容、慢查询优化;
- 团队技术能力:无Python/Docker经验者需额外投入学习或外包部署,时间成本显著上升;
- 是否启用增强模块:如 OCR 商品图文字识别、PDF TRO文件解析等插件,依赖额外GPU或专用API调用。
为了拿到准确部署成本,你通常需要准备:监控站点数量、日均采集SKU量、目标国家站点列表、现有服务器配置、是否已有PostgreSQL/Redis实例。
常见坑与避坑清单
- 坑1: 直接运行
python main.py而非docker-compose,导致 Playwright 浏览器环境缺失 → 避坑: 严格按 README.md 的 Docker 方式启动,勿绕过容器化; - 坑2:
.env中POSTGRES_URL格式错误(如漏写postgresql://前缀)→ 避坑: 使用psql $POSTGRES_URL -c "SELECT version();"验证连接性; - 坑3: 未关闭 Ubuntu 防火墙(ufw)或云安全组未放行 5432/6379/8000 端口 → 避坑: 部署后立即执行
curl -v http://localhost:8000/api/health和telnet localhost 5432双验证; - 坑4: 在低配机器(如1C1G)上同时跑 DB + Worker + Web,OOM kill 导致服务反复重启 → 避坑: 至少分配 2C4G,或拆分服务至不同主机(参考
docker-compose.prod.yml分离部署模板)。
FAQ
{关键词} 靠谱吗/正规吗/是否合规?
OpenClaw 是 MIT 协议开源项目,代码完全公开可审计,不包含后门或数据回传逻辑;其采集行为需严格遵守目标网站 robots.txt 及各国《计算机欺诈与滥用法》(如美国CFAA)、《欧盟GDPR》相关条款。是否合规取决于你配置的请求频率、User-Agent、登录态使用方式 —— 不登录、不高频、不绕过反爬,属合理使用范畴;商用前建议法务评估采集范围与用途。
{关键词} 适合哪些卖家/平台/地区/类目?
适合具备基础运维能力的中大型跨境团队(有DevOps或技术对接人),主要应用于 Amazon、Walmart、Target、Shopee、Lazada 等支持结构化页面的平台;对 TikTok Shop、Temu 等强JS渲染/动态接口平台支持有限;适用于电子配件、家居、美妆等易发TRO、政策变动频繁的类目;当前对北美、欧洲、东南亚站点兼容性最佳,拉美、中东需自行适配 selector。
{关键词} 常见失败原因是什么?如何排查?
最常见失败原因前三:① Chromium 下载中断(查看 docker logs openclaw-worker-1 是否含 playwright install timeout);② PostgreSQL 初始化失败(检查 docker logs openclaw-db-1 是否报 password authentication failed);③ Redis 连接超时(确认 REDIS_URL 中 host 是否为 redis 而非 localhost)。排查优先级:先 docker logs,再 docker exec -it 进容器手动测试连通性,最后比对 docker-compose.yml 网络配置。
结尾
2026实战OpenClaw(龙虾)如何安装,本质是技术基建动作,非开箱即用型服务 —— 成功率取决于环境可控性与配置严谨度。

